Understanding the Philips Hue Ecosystem
To maximize the functionality of your Philips Hue smart lighting system, it’s essential to grasp the overall ecosystem. Here’s a breakdown of key components within the Philips Hue environment to help you streamline your smart home setup:
Philips Hue Bridge
The Philips Hue Bridge serves as the central hub for connecting your Philips Hue lights to your Wi-Fi network. It acts as the communication bridge between your smart devices and Hue lights, enabling control and automation functionalities. By connecting your Hue Bridge to the internet, you can control your lights remotely through the Philips Hue app.
Philips Hue Lights
These smart LED bulbs are the heart of the Philips Hue system. With a wide range of options, including white ambiance, color ambiance, and outdoor lights, Philips Hue offers versatile lighting solutions for various preferences and needs. You can adjust brightness, color temperature, and color settings to create the right ambiance for any occasion.
Philips Hue App
The Philips Hue mobile app provides a user-friendly interface to control and customize your smart lights. You can create schedules, set up routines, and manage multiple rooms or zones within your home. The app also supports integration with voice assistants like Alexa, Google Assistant, and Siri, adding voice control capabilities to your smart lighting system.
Third-Party Integrations
Philips Hue is compatible with a wide range of smart home platforms and devices, allowing seamless integration with popular ecosystems like Apple HomeKit, Amazon Alexa, Google Home, and Samsung SmartThings. This compatibility enables you to expand your smart home capabilities and create a unified ecosystem that works across different brands and devices.
Philips Hue Sync
For a more immersive lighting experience, Philips Hue Sync syncs your lights with music, movies, and games, creating dynamic lighting effects that complement the content displayed on your screen. This feature enhances entertainment experiences and adds an extra layer of interactivity to your smart lighting setup.

Comparing Wink Hub and Philips Hue Bridge
When deciding between a Wink Hub and a Philips Hue Bridge for your smart home setup, it’s essential to understand the differences in their functionalities and how they can complement each other. Here’s a comparison to help you make an informed choice:
Centralized Control:
- Wink Hub: Acts as a central control unit for various smart home devices, allowing you to manage different brands and products from a single interface.
- Philips Hue Bridge: Specifically designed to control Philips Hue smart lights and accessories, offering seamless integration within the Hue ecosystem.
Compatibility:
- Wink Hub: Supports a wide range of protocols and devices, making it versatile for connecting with various smart home gadgets beyond just lighting.
- Philips Hue Bridge: Primarily focuses on controlling Philips Hue lights and may have limitations in integrating with non-Hue smart devices.
Customization Options:
- Wink Hub: Provides advanced customization features for creating personalized automation rules and scenarios tailored to your specific preferences.
- Philips Hue Bridge: Offers lighting-specific customization such as color adjustments, scenes, routines, and syncing with entertainment content for immersive experiences.
Third-Party Integrations:
- Wink Hub: Extensive compatibility with third-party products and platforms, allowing for broader integration possibilities with different smart home ecosystems.
- Philips Hue Bridge: While compatible with certain third-party apps and services, its integration options may be more limited compared to the Wink Hub.
- Wink Hub: Offers local control capabilities, ensuring device functionality even if the internet connection is down, which can be crucial for maintaining uninterrupted automation.
- Philips Hue Bridge: Relies on internet connectivity for remote access and control, which may pose limitations during network outages impacting smart home operations.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can a Wink Hub work with Philips Hue lights?
Yes, a Wink Hub can work with Philips Hue lights through the use of third-party integrations like IFTTT or Stringify. This allows you to control your Philips Hue lights alongside other smart devices connected to the Wink Hub.
What are the differences between Wink Hub and Philips Hue Bridge?
The Wink Hub offers broader compatibility with various smart home devices and advanced customization features. In contrast, the Philips Hue Bridge focuses on seamless integration within the Hue ecosystem and provides enhanced control over Philips Hue lights.
Which one is better for centralized control, Wink Hub, or Philips Hue Bridge?
The Wink Hub is better for centralized control due to its broader compatibility and the ability to control different smart home devices from one hub. Meanwhile, the Philips Hue Bridge is more suitable for those heavily invested in the Philips Hue ecosystem.
Are there any limitations when using Wink Hub and Philips Hue together?
The main limitation when using Wink Hub and Philips Hue together is that the integration is not as seamless as using devices within the same ecosystem. Third-party integrations may sometimes result in delays or compatibility issues.
